Beetlex ('bee-tul-lex')

Across the world, these tiny insect Mystimon are considered an invasive species and a pest. Originating from Olympus before they hitched a ride on ships and spread to the four corners of the globe, they have now irrevocably damaged the ecosystem in Atlantea, Southern Almahna, and the Quatrica Islands. While bites are rare, when they do occur, they can inject a venom which could kill a person in a matter of hours. These are creatures you most assuredly do not want infesting your home.

Ecology and Habitats

Beetlex will make their home anywhere there is wood. In the woods and forests, they will feed on the trees, usually fallen trees. But they have now started to infest people's homes as well, any that are constructed of wood. They are a large part of the reason most buildings in Almahna are constructed of sandstone, not wood. They appear to be particularly fond of heartwood from Olympus, but they will consume any wood.

Fortunately for the Vikarahn, Highwind is far too cold for them, as they prefer areas that are warm or temperate, and can't really function in cold climates, where they in fact go into hibernation, as they do in the winter in Atlantea.

Behaviour

They are an extremely invasive pest species which will spread extremely rapidly. They appear driven to do two things, to feed on wood and to make more of themselves. To this end, they will avoid contact with people as much as they can. In homes, they prefer cool dark areas, such as the basement or cellar, perhaps the attic.

Geographic Origin and Distribution

They were originally native only to Olympus, but in the late Second Age, they began hitching rides on ships bound for Almahna and Atlantea. Once in those areas, they spread extremely quickly and irrevocably damaged the ecosystems in those areas.
